Official abstract text for this publication.
An ion exchangeable glass having a high degree of resistance to damage caused by abrasion, scratching, indentation, and the like. The glass comprises alumina, B 2 O 3 , and alkali metal oxides, and contains boron cations having three-fold coordination. The glass, when ion exchanged, has a Vickers crack initiation threshold of at least 10 kilogram force (kgf).

The invention claimed is: 1. A glass comprising: 66-74 mol % SiO 2 ; 9-20 mol % Na 2 O; 9-22 mol % Al 2 O 3 ; at least 2.7 mol % B 2 O 3 ; at least 0.1 mol % of at least one of MgO and ZnO, wherein R 2 O(mol %)+CaO(mol %)+SrO(mol %)+BaO(mol %)−Al 2 O 3 (mol %)−B 2 O 3 (mol %)<0 mol %. 2. The glass of claim 1 wherein the glass comprises 3-4.5 mol % B 2 O 3 . 3. The glass of claim 1 wherein the glass comprises 2.7-4.5 mol % B 2 O 3 . 4. The glass of claim 1 wherein the glass comprises 3-10 mol % B 2 O 3 . 5. The glass of claim 1 wherein the glass comprises at least about 10 mol % R 2 O. 6. The glass of claim 1 wherein the glass is substantially free of Li 2 O. 7. The glass of claim 1 wherein the glass comprises at least one of CaO, BaO, and SrO. 8. The glass of claim 1 , wherein the glass comprises: from about 10 mol % to about 20 mol % Na 2 O; from 0 mol % to about 5 mol % K 2 O; 0 mol %≦MgO≦6 mol %; 0 mol % ≦ZnO≦6 mol %; and 0 mol %≦CaO(mol %)+SrO(mol %)+BaO(mol %)≦2 mol %. 9. The glass of claim 1 , wherein B 2 O 3 (mol %)-(R 2 O(mol%) - Al 2 O 3 (mol %))≦4.5 mol %. 10. The glass of claim 1 wherein B 2 O 3 (mol %)−(R 2 O(mol %)−Al 2 O 3 (mol %))≧3 mol %. 11. The glass of claim 1 wherein 3 mol %≦B 2 O 3 (mol %)−(R 2 O(mol %)−Al 2 O 3 (mol %))≦4.5 mol %. 12. The glass of claim 1 wherein the glass has a zirconia breakdown temperature that is equal to the temperature at which the glass has a viscosity in a range from about 30 kPoise to about 40 kPoise. 13. The glass of claim 1 , wherein the glass contains less than about one inclusion per kilogram of glass, the inclusion having a diameter of at least 50 μm. 14. The glass of claim 1 wherein the glass is ion exchangeable. 15. The glass of claim 1 wherein the glass is ion exchanged and has a layer under a compressive stress of at least about 600 MPa, the layer extending from a surface of the glass into the glass to a depth of layer of at least about 30 μm. 16. The glass of claim 1 wherein the compressive stress is at least about 800 MPa. 17. The glass of claim 1 wherein the glass is ion exchanged and has a Vickers crack initiation threshold in a range from about 20 kgf to about 30 kgf. 18. The glass of claim 1 , wherein the glass is ion exchanged and has a Vickers crack initiation threshold in a range from about 30 kgf to about 35 kgf.
